Description: Trace 100 years of Progress for People as an "Audio- Animatronics" family demonstrates the many conveniences made possible in American life by a century of innovations in electricity.

pho_carpro.jpg (17996 bytes)

One of the most popular attractions in Tomorrowland since 1974, Carousel of Progress has a new look -- both inside and out.

The musical comedy show has been seen by more guests than any other theatrical presentation in the history of American Theater since its debut at the 1964 World’s Fair.

The show traces the impact of technological progress on Americans’ daily living from the start of the 20th century into the near future with a cast of family characters brought to life through Disney’s Audio-Animatronics effects.

Through an added pre-show, guests discover more about the original Carousel show designed by Walt Disney, and hear the return of the original theme song, "There’s a Great Big Beautiful Tomorrow." With an updated script and new cast of voices, guests get a glimpse of innovations like virtual-reality, voice-activation and high-definition television.
